How to debug the circulating water dosing system and what are the requirements for installation?

During commissioning of circulating water dosing system, first confirm the connection of power and water source, and then adjust the equipment to an appropriate point for braking operation; In terms of installation, the drug dissolving box of the dosing system is the place where the drug outlet is higher than the drug inlet of the dosing pump, and the console should be clean and bright with the original strong magnetic field; Then let's introduce the relevant contents in detail.

1、 Commissioning method of circulating water dosing system

1. Check whether the water source and power supply are connected.

2. Set the control button of the electric cabinet to the "manual" position, and check whether each equipment is intact and whether the motor direction is correct one by one (open the valve on the water inlet pipe when checking the direction of the feed motor).

3. Manually move the floating ball of the box up and down one by one to see whether the signal can be sent normally, and then detect whether the material level alarm in the hopper can work normally.

4. Put dry PAM solid powder (not less than 5kg) into the hopper and put a suitable container at the feed inlet.

5. Open the water inlet valve, press the start button of the feeding motor, start feeding at this time, and stop feeding after running for one minute.

6. Weigh the polymer mass in the container and make records.

7. Repeat the above steps 5 and 6, and predict the average weight of the Fed powder through the feeder.

8. Repeat the above three steps and make records. Since the feed rate is controlled and the speed of the feeder is known, the feed rate curve can be drawn for future reference. The solution can also be prepared by directly adjusting the powder dosage and water inflow to a certain value (for example, when preparing a 5 ‰ PAM solution of 1000L / h, the powder dosage can be directly adjusted to 5kg / h and the water inflow can be 1000L / h).

9. Stop the feeder.

10. Turn the control switch in the electric cabinet to "automatic".

11. When the liquid level reaches the high level, the feeder shall be able to stop automatically, stop water inlet at the same time, and start the metering pump (or open the vent ball valve of the liquid storage chamber). When the liquid level reaches the low level, the feeder shall be able to automatically start feeding and water inlet.

12. Adjust the stroke of the metering pump to the appropriate point, and then it can enter the automatic operation state.

2、 Installation requirements of circulating water dosing system

1. The nozzle of the dosing pipe shall reverse the flow direction and be inserted into the center line of the medium pipe. The dosing pipe is 10-15mm stainless steel pipe, and about 10 2mm small holes are evenly opened around the pipe end accessories.

2. The sample tube is countercurrent inserted into the medium tube through 3 / 4, and several small holes with a diameter of 3mm are drilled in 1 / 3-2 / 3 of the end of the sample tube to increase the representativeness of sampling.

3. The distance between the dosing inlet and the sampling port should be 10-15m.

4. The length of the sample water pipeline between the sampling point and the electrode of the pH meter should be greater than 20m. Since most power plant pipelines have been finalized and it is inconvenient to change, this situation has been fully considered in the program design scheme of the controller.

5. The control cabinet shall be clean, bright and free of corrosive gas, away from strong magnetic field, with temperature less than 45 ° C and humidity less than 85%.

6. The drug dissolving box shall be installed so that the drug outlet is higher than the drug inlet of the dosing pump.
